Felting is a fun and creative activity that changes airy and light wool strands into solid fabrics and forms. We’ll use a foam pad, a needle and wool roving (wool prepared for spinning) to do our felting. No experience necessary; materials are included.
On this date we’ll be felting a bird.
This program will also be offered on October 20th and March 9th, felting an appliqué and an Easter egg.
